Oscar Peterson For Lovers, released on 24 August 2004 via Verve Reissues, is a sublime collection of jazz masterpieces that showcases the incomparable talent of Oscar Peterson. This 46-minute album is a treasure trove of romantic ballads and elegant melodies, featuring timeless classics such as 'My One And Only Love', 'The Man I Love', and 'Over The Rainbow'.

Oscar Peterson, the legendary Canadian jazz pianist and composer, stands as one of the most revered figures in the history of jazz. Born in Montreal in 1925, Peterson's career spanned over six decades, during which he released more than 200 recordings and won eight Grammy Awards, including a lifetime achievement award. Known for his dazzling solo technique and virtuosic skill, Peterson was dubbed the "Maharaja of the keyboard" by Duke Ellington and the "King of inside swing" within the jazz community. His collaborations with renowned musicians and his ability to redefine swing for modern jazz pianists cemented his status as a true master of the genre. Peterson's music, characterized by its technical brilliance and expressive freedom, continues to inspire generations of musicians and jazz enthusiasts alike.
